Care Guidance:
- Operate in fresh(tap) water only and check routinely to see if this needs topping up
- Periodically change the water to keep the flow, the water fountain itself and pump clean
- Remove scale and build-up regularly. We recommend purchasing Drift & Flow Algae Stop as a preventative treatment, which can be obtained through all good Garden Centre Retailers.
- DO NOT use any harmful additives such as bleach or chlorine. Only use a specific Water Fountain treatment as indicated above.
- DO NOT use anything abrasive to scrub the Water Fountain
- DO NOT use a pressure washer
- Always shut off the power supply before cleaning ad maintaining your Water Fountain
- Always switch off your Water Fountain before leaving home for sustained periods of time
Winter Care
During colder months and in particular freezing conditions, we recommend draining the Water Fountain, disconnecting the pump and shoring this indoors if possible. Allowing ice to build up in your Water Fountain, or subjecting it to changing temperatures can cause a number of issues, such as cracking, paint finish damage, pump and light failure, etc.
Before storing your Water Fountain, remove the pump and transformer than clean any lime or debris. Dry the surface gently with a clean and ensure his is packed away safety, away from anything that could cause damage
